Hey, Ryun's began to study the ancient language as per request of his master.

But as the moment i'm only getting the response

"you dont understand anything written in the text book" (or something smiliar).

I havnt gotten the ancient language at all in the skillbar.

I do meet the int requirement (18 int).

Do i just need to keep trying with page 1 (counter set to 1) to get it to work?
or is there any other requirements, like per say the Mage rune (marks you as a mage, like the equal rune that marks you a druid) ?

Two things to know:

The cut off number for learning Ancient is not 16int rather its 13int

Learning Ancient is not actually a requirement to using the magic system, It's rather a highly practiced RP Tradition. How well you speak ancient will have no effect on your actual casting.

As to your learning issue:

Did your teacher remember to add the note to the book for you?

give him or her the book back have them use the book along with some ink. After that you should be able to read from the ancient book and get your preliminary ancient skill. Good luck
